Implementation of Graphing Tools by Direct GUI Composition
نویسندگان
چکیده
we describe an object oriented design and flexible implementation of a set of graphing tools implemented by using only the standard graphical user interface widgets provided by an interactive program composition system developed at Siemens Corporate R&D. The system, SX/Tools, allows for the addition of arbitrary tools (widgets) by direct composition of a set of initial objects. Using this mechanism and without any further system programming we were able to design a powerful set of graphing tools for applications ranging from static displays of data, to business graphs, to dynamically varying data and maintaining interactive rates.
منابع مشابه
Performance Cockpit: An Extensible GUI Platform for Performance Tools
Within the EP-Cache project, the Performance Cockpit has been developed to provide a unified GUI for a series of performance tools. This is achieved through the establishment of a general extensible architecture and the application of standardized intermediate representations of program structures. This paper describes the design and implementation of this platform, and discusses the future evo...
متن کاملBMI-for-age graphs with severe obesity percentile curves: tools for plotting cross-sectional and longitudinal youth BMI data
BACKGROUND Severe obesity is an important and distinct weight status classification that is associated with disease risk and is increasing in prevalence among youth. The ability to graphically present population weight status data, ranging from underweight through severe obesity class 3, is novel and applicable to epidemiologic research, intervention studies, case reports, and clinical care. ...
متن کاملDesign & Development of the Graphical User Interface for Sindhi Language
This paper describes the design and implementation of a Unicode-based GUISL (Graphical User Interface for Sindhi Language). The idea is to provide a software platform to the people of Sindh as well as Sindhi diasporas living across the globe to make use of computing for basic tasks such as editing, composition, formatting, and printing of documents in Sindhi by using GUISL. The implementation o...
متن کاملFunctional Algebra with the use of the Graphing Calculator
Algebra is a very important topic in mathematical programs for upper secondary education, but a vast majority of students is weak in understanding and using formal algebraic tools. This paper discusses some ideas about using the graphing calculator to support the learning of algebra in the context of functions and to help students overcome algebra-anxiety. Accepting the graphing calculator as a...
متن کاملCoML: Yet Another, But Simple Component Composition Language
Components offer various advantages, such as platform and tool independence but composition languages do not address the same independence. We present a platform independent component composition language called Component Markup Language. CoML offers abstractions for component composition and for meta information. We envision different usage scenarios for CoML as a resource script or input for ...
متن کامل